Форум программистов, компьютерный форум, киберфорум
C# для начинающих
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.91/11: Рейтинг темы: голосов - 11, средняя оценка - 4.91
Alvin Seville
331 / 264 / 131
Регистрация: 25.07.2014
Сообщений: 4,537
Записей в блоге: 9
1

Куда компилятор csc.exe кладёт скомпилированные .exe/.dll?

29.01.2020, 01:00. Просмотров 1986. Ответов 4
Метки нет (Все метки)

Куда компилятор csc.exe кладёт скомпилированные .exe/.dll? Есть батник, компиляция проекта в Visual Studio происходит успешно, никаких ошибок батник не выдаёт, но я не могу найти файлов .exe в папке с .cs файлами.
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
29.01.2020, 01:00
Ответы с готовыми решениями:

Не получается компиляция csc.exe
Здравствуйте! Пробую скомпилировать файл TestApp.cs, который лежит в папке C:\MyApplication. В...

Как откомпилировать с помощью csc.exe?
Как с помощю csc.exe из program.cs получить program.exe?

Как пользоваться компилятором командной строки csc.exe?
Сегодня только начала учить С# по книге Г.Шилдта . И столкнулась с проблемой запуска элементарной...

Невозможно найти исполняемый файл компилятора csc.exe
Всем привет, вот такая проблема возникла при установке приложения, как ее устранить?

4
Alvin Seville
331 / 264 / 131
Регистрация: 25.07.2014
Сообщений: 4,537
Записей в блоге: 9
29.01.2020, 09:01  [ТС] 2
Вопрос актуален.
0
101 / 73 / 29
Регистрация: 05.04.2015
Сообщений: 413
29.01.2020, 09:36 3
Лучший ответ Сообщение было отмечено Соколиный глаз как решение

Решение

Куда напишешь пр:csc.exe class.cs d:\class.exe
1
Alvin Seville
331 / 264 / 131
Регистрация: 25.07.2014
Сообщений: 4,537
Записей в блоге: 9
30.01.2020, 07:45  [ТС] 4
zhunshun, я директорию куда класть не указывал. Я предполагал, что .cs файлики скомпилированные будут находится с исходниками в той же папке.
0
901 / 787 / 328
Регистрация: 08.02.2014
Сообщений: 2,386
30.01.2020, 10:10 5
Лучший ответ Сообщение было отмечено Соколиный глаз как решение

Решение

Соколиный глаз, у Вас батник неверный
1)
Bash
1
set "csharpExamplesFolder=%~2NETMouse - .NET release\Examples\C#\"
тут будет искать папку относительно папки в которой вы запустите батник, в Вашем случае относительно папки Actions, Вам нужно добавить в эту строку выход на каталог назад и оставить только ..\Examples\C#\
2) выходные данные будут в папке вместе с батником, а не cs файлами
3) файлы ABCNET.dll и ABCNET.xml по Вашему батнику тоже должны лежать рядом с ним

не знаю как вы не видели ошибки, но если взять проект и собрать батником это сразу видно всё
1
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
30.01.2020, 10:10

Заказываю контрольные, курсовые, дипломные и любые другие студенческие работы здесь.

Ошибка при попытке запуска компилятора csc.exe
При запуске из командной строки команды команды: csc C:\myproject.cs выдается сообщение: "csc не...

Как подключить к .cs файлу библиотеку и выполнить её компиляцию через csc.exe?
Как подключить к .cs файлу библиотеку и выполнить её компиляцию через csc.exe? Библиотека находится...

CSharpCodeProvider. Ошибка "Невозможно найти исполняемый файл компилятора csc.exe."
Мне необходимо было написать программу, одна из задач - можно редактировать код самой же этой...

Куда сохраняется exe файл после команды?
Я задавал вопрос "Как собрать из кода приложение". Мне ответили. Я всё сделал. Сборка > собрать...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
5
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2020, vBulletin Solutions, Inc.